水驱砂岩油藏生产井出口端含水饱和度的确定方法  

Determination of Exit-End Formation Water Saturation of Oil Well in Water Drive Sandstone Reservoir

摘  要:依据油藏工程理论,推导出了油水两相渗流条件下用含水率求解油层含水饱和度的方程,并借助含水率与含水饱和度的关系曲线,推导出确定砂岩水驱油藏生产井出口端地层含水饱和度的方程。应用实例表明,该方法在断层少,含油层系单一的小型断块油气田具有一定的实用价值。Based on reservoir engineering theory, this paper provides a formula for solving water saturation by water cut in the conditions of oil and water seepage flow. With the relationship curve of water cut and water saturation, the formula which calculates water saturation of exit-end formation oil well in water drive sand stone reservoir is derived. The method is practical for the small fault-block oil and gas fields, which are a few fault and simple reservoir.
